Technical Specifications and File Compatibility
A critical factor in the usability of any digital asset is its format versatility. The 3D Christmas Village SVG Papercut Paperc package is designed to accommodate a wide range of software and hardware capabilities. Upon purchase, users receive a zipped folder containing:
- 2 AI Files: Ideal for users working within Adobe Illustrator, allowing for extensive customization of colors, fonts, and paths before export.
- 2 SVG Files: The standard format for most modern cutting machines, ensuring broad compatibility with platforms like Cricut Design Space and Silhouette Studio.
- 2 EPS Files: Useful for professional workflows involving CorelDRAW or older versions of Illustrator, ensuring stability in print-ready environments.
- 24 PNG Files: Provided as separate layers, these raster images are valuable for previewing the design in photo editing software or for creating mockups without needing vector editing tools.
This diverse file selection ensures that whether you are a graphic designer needing editable source files or a crafter looking for plug-and-play cutting instructions, the asset fits your workflow. The inclusion of separate PNG layers also aids in visualization, helping users understand how the final 3D structure will look before committing to material costs.
Quality Analysis: Node Minimization and Detail
One of the most significant technical strengths of the 3D Christmas Village SVG Papercut Paperc is the attention paid to node optimization. In vector design, excessive nodes can lead to sluggish performance in editing software and potential errors during the cutting process. The designers behind this asset have minimized the number of nodes in each design while maintaining high detail quality. This approach yields several practical benefits:
- Processing Efficiency: Files with optimized nodes load faster and handle more smoothly in both desktop and cloud-based design applications.
- Cutting Precision: Fewer unnecessary points reduce the risk of "ghost cuts" or minor deviations in the final physical product, resulting in cleaner edges and better alignment between layers.
- Scalability: Because the vectors are clean and well-structured, the designs can be scaled up or down without losing integrity. This is crucial for creators who may want to produce different sizes of the same village scene for various price points or display areas.
The high level of detail preserved despite node minimization means that intricate elements like window panes, roof textures, and snow accents remain crisp. This balance between complexity and efficiency is often difficult to achieve, making this asset particularly noteworthy for professional users who demand reliability.

Potential Limitations and Considerations
While the 3D Christmas Village SVG Papercut Paperc is a high-quality asset, it is important to acknowledge certain limitations based on its nature.
Material Constraints: As a papercut design, the final output is dependent on the material chosen. Thin cardstock may not hold the 3D structure as well as thicker foam board or wood veneer. Users must consider the weight and rigidity of their materials to ensure the layered structure remains stable.
Assembly Complexity: With twelve layers per design, assembly requires patience and precision. Glue placement and alignment are critical. Beginners may find the stacking process challenging initially, requiring practice to achieve a neat finish. However, for experienced crafters, this complexity is part of the appeal, offering a satisfying build process.
Color Customization: While the vector files allow for color changes, the default presentation may rely on traditional Christmas hues. Users looking for non-traditional color schemes (e.g., monochrome or pastel) will need to invest time in recoloring the layers, which is feasible given the AI and SVG formats but requires some design effort.
